Actionable Recommendations for Navigating the AI Jungle

So, how do you navigate this AI jungle effectively? Here are some practical steps:

  • Start Small: Identify specific areas where AI can make an immediate impact—like customer service automation or inventory management.
  • Focus on Data: Ensure your data is clean, structured, and comprehensive, as it’s the lifeblood of any AI system.
  • Prioritize Ethics: Implement AI with a focus on transparency and ethical usage to build trust with your customers.
  • Iterate and Evolve: Continuously monitor AI performance, learn from outcomes, and make necessary adjustments.
